M&M White Chocolate Peppermint Popcorn
White Chocolate, peppermint and crunchy peanut and milk chocolate M&Ms combine with popcorn for an amazingly easy yet delicious recipe
Ingredients
  • 1 cup Milk chocolate M&M'S® Chocolate Candies
  • 1 cup Peanut M&M'S® Chocolate Candies
  • 8 cups Orville Redenbacher Kettle popcorn
  • 11 ounces White chocolate chips
  • 1 tablespoon peppermint extract
  • Optional: crushed candy canes
Instructions
  1. Pop popcorn
  2. In a food processor or with a mallet, crush ½ cup of milk chocolate M&M'S® and ½ cup of the Peanut M&M'S®
  3. Melt white chocolate chips in microwave according to package instructions
  4. Add peppermint extract to the white chocolate
  5. Pour white chocolate over the popcorn and mix in m&ms, stir until mixed thoroughly
  6. Pour popcorn mixture on a wax paper lined baking sheet to set
  7. Optional: garnish with M&M'S® Chocolate Candies and crushed candy canes.
  8. Eat and enjoy!
